Technical Specifications
Product Line: 600 Series (PGP/PGM 620/640) Heavy-Duty High-Performance External Hydraulic Gear Pumps & Motors (100% cross-compatible with Parker Commercial standards)
Core Covered Specific Configurations & Cross-Mapping:
7029110058 Configuration (Proprietary Parker 10-digit commercial ordering code, part of the high-frequency PGP620 replacement segment)
PGP620A0230CA1H2NB1B1E6E5 Layout (PGP620 designates the 620 gear frame; A signifies a single-section pump structure; 0230 indicates a 23.0 cc/rev geometric volumetric displacement; C specifies a standard SAE B 2-bolt mounting flange; A1 denotes a standard 13-tooth involute splined input shaft; H2 represents a specific side-mounted split-flange port configuration; suffixes like N1B1E6E5 define internal standard seal matrices, thrust plate configurations, and factory rear cover designs)
Volumetric Frame Size Displacement Matrix:
620 Series 通径段: Comprehensive displacement range from 16.0 $cc/rev$ up to 52.0 $cc/rev$ (This model offers precisely 23.0 $cc/rev$)
640 Series 通径段: Heavy-duty large displacement range from 60.0 $cc/rev$ up to 100.0 $cc/rev$
Continuous Rated Operating Pressure Boundaries: Up to 275 bar (27.5 MPa / 4000 psi) continuous duty loading envelope
Maximum Intermittent Intermittent Peak Pressure Bound: Rated up to 310 bar (31 MPa / 4500 psi) resisting abrupt fluid shock or system relief overshoots
Maximum Permissible Input Rotational Speed Range: From 3000 rpm up to 3500 rpm depending on specific frame size volumetric capacity
Minimum Stable Operating Idle Speed (PGM Motor): 400 rpm to 500 rpm
Primary Structural Metallurgy: Heavy-duty ductile iron front and rear covers matched with a premium, high-density extruded aluminum alloy center casing (full cast-iron builds available for specialized environments)
Multi-Stage Tandem Stacking Capability: 100% rated for multi-section configurations (double, triple, or quadruple tandem setups) utilizing internal splined connecting couplings and independent zero-leakage section seals
Key Technical Advantages:
Composite Ductile Iron & Aerospace Aluminum Architecture: The 600 series utilizes high-tensile ductile iron front and rear covers combined with a heavy-tonnage, hot-extruded aluminum alloy center housing. This structural configuration layout minimizes radial casing expansion under continuous 275 bar loads, preventing premature wear between the gear teeth tips and the internal housing walls.
Hydrostatically Balanced Thrust Plates with Automated Axial Compensation: The gear faces are flanked by precision-machined alloy thrust plates featuring integrated “3-shaped” hydrostatic pressure seals and anti-extrusion backing blocks on their rear faces. This arrangement routes pressurized system oil behind the plates, providing optimal clamping force against the gear faces for automatic axial clearance compensation and a sustained volumetric efficiency above 94%.
One-Piece Forged Alloy Steel Gears with Optimized Tooth Geometry: Both the drive and driven gear shafts are forged from premium case-hardened alloy steel (e.g., 20CrMnTi), followed by precise profile grinding. The gear tooth geometry is hydrodynamically optimized to reduce fluid trapping and output pressure ripples, ensuring consistent fluid delivery while keeping full-load operating noise below 72 dB.
Heavy-Duty Monolithic DU Journal Bushings for Low-Friction Operation: The internal gear shafts run on high-capacity, single-piece PTFE-lined composite journal bushings instead of needle bearings. This setup provides excellent vibration damping when handling minor input shaft deflection or small radial preloads, eliminating the risk of catastrophic pump failure due to loose roller needles.

Expert Maintenance Tips:
Verify Total Input Torque Thresholds on Multi-Stage Tandem Assemblies: In multi-stage assemblies using the PGP620 platform, the primary drive shaft (such as the A1 13-tooth splined shaft in this model) transfers the combined torque of all downstream sections. When coupling the pump to a prime mover, always verify that the total operating torque does not exceed the main input shaft’s shear limit. Never use a hammer to force a coupling onto the shaft, as axial impacts can damage the internal positioning components and thrust plates.
Prevent Aeration and Dry-Run Scuffing in Aluminum Center Sections: Extruded aluminum gear pumps are highly sensitive to air ingestion. If the intake line draws air due to hose aging or loose clamps, or if the unit is started dry, running for even 30 seconds can cause rapid friction welding (galling) between the steel gears and the aluminum wear plates, leading to a locked rotor condition. Ensure all intake connections are vacuum-tight.
Mandatory System Flushing and Filter Optimization Prior to Retrofitting: When replacing an original pump assembly (such as a worn 7029110058), fine metallic debris from the failure remains suspended in the system oil. Before installing the new pump, flush all hydraulic lines, thoroughly clean the main reservoir, and replace both suction and return filter elements. Maintain a fluid cleanliness standard of ISO 4406 19/16 or NAS 8 to protect the new components from scoring.
